I'm an Applications Systems Analyst with a background in both molecular biology and computer programing. I have been working with the BCF since Nov. 2006. I design, develop, and manage robust LIMS (laboratory information systems) to organize data generated by UAGC 's high-throughput, automated workflows. Our systems pair reliable and scalable back-end databases with easy to use RIA web interfaces for our end users.
BCF LIMS help ensure the quality and efficiency of laboratory workflows by supporting the following areas:
- sample and inventory management
- assay results data archival, retrieval, quality control, and analysis
- automated reaction setup
- billing
Some of the projects I am currently working on:
- GAPSS - Python LIMS server.
- SLM - Flex RIA front-end to GAPSS.
- Plater - Python LIMS library used by GAPSS.
- Ilima - Python/Postgres/Dojo laboratory inventory control.
- SopWiki - interactive SOP editor with version support and manager approval process based on TWiki.
- CaLims II - Java based LIMS being developed by NCICB.
